You can store the Caller ID data in the sys-
tem’s Abbreviated Dial Table or in one of
your One Touch keys.
1. With a keyset in an idle condition, press
the LIST Soft Key.
2. Press the CID Soft Key (Caller ID). The
display shows:
## = List Number
xx = Caller ID number
mm-dd hh:mm = incoming date/time
↑
= Preview List
↓
= Next List
Store = Store in List
DEL = Delete from List
3. Press the STORE Soft Key. The display
shows:
## = List Number
xx = Caller ID number
mm-dd hh:mm = incoming date/time
OneT = Store in One-Touch key
ABBc = Store in Common Abbreviated Dial
bin
ABBg = Store in Group Abbreviated Dial bin
4. Press the ABBC or ABBG Soft Key.
5. Dial the Abbreviated Dial bin in which
the number is to be stored.
If you press HOLD, the next avail-
able Abbreviated Dial bin will be used.
If all Abbreviated Dial bins are used,
the display shows “TABLE IS FULL”.
